Who Qualifies for a Medical Cannabis Card in Enterprise, AL
Not everyone will meet the requirements, but many patients with serious health conditions may be eligible. Qualifying conditions include:
Chronic pain not managed by standard treatments
Epilepsy and seizure disorders
Cancer-related nausea, appetite loss, or weight changes
PTSD and anxiety disorders
Parkinson’s disease, Crohn’s disease, spasticity, and more
Patients must show medical records and proof that other treatments have been tried or ruled out.
What Happens During a Cannabis Evaluation
If you are seeking a medical marijuana doctor in Enterprise, AL, here’s what the process usually looks like:
Collect Medical Records – Documentation of your diagnosis and treatments is required.
Schedule an Appointment – Only doctors with state certification can perform cannabis evaluations.
In-Person Visit – The doctor reviews your health history, symptoms, and treatment failures.
Certification – If you qualify, the physician will issue a recommendation for medical cannabis.
Patient Registry – You are entered into Alabama’s official medical cannabis registry, giving you legal access to purchase from licensed dispensaries.
What Patients in Enterprise Should Expect
Limited Local Options: Enterprise may have fewer certified doctors at first, though more will become available as the program expands.
Out-of-Pocket Costs: Insurance does not typically cover cannabis evaluations or certifications.
Strict Rules: Alabama regulates forms, dosages, and possession limits carefully.
Renewal Visits: Certifications must be renewed regularly to stay valid.
